Global Climate Shift Accelerates: Scientists Urge Action Amidst Mounting Evidence

Recent scientific reports underscore the accelerating pace of global climate change, revealing widespread impacts from extreme weather to ecological shifts. Experts emphasize the critical need for immediate, concerted global efforts to mitigate its most severe consequences.

The latest assessments from international scientific bodies confirm an intensifying trajectory for global climate change, with average planetary temperatures continuing their upward trend. Data indicates a clear link between human activities, particularly the emission of greenhouse gases, and the observed warming patterns.

Consequences are increasingly evident worldwide, manifesting as more frequent and intense extreme weather events, including heatwaves, droughts, and unprecedented rainfall. Ecologically, shifts are being observed in species distribution and natural cycles, posing significant threats to biodiversity and food security.

Governments and organizations globally are grappling with both mitigation – reducing emissions – and adaptation – adjusting to unavoidable changes. While international agreements aim to limit warming, the pace and scale of implementation remain crucial points of discussion and challenge.

Experts reiterate the urgency of transitioning to sustainable energy sources, enhancing carbon capture technologies, and fostering resilient communities. The coming decade is widely considered pivotal in shaping the long-term future of the planet and its inhabitants.
